Cystic Renal Dysplasia

•The photograph shows the upper pole of a kidney amputated for renal dysplasia. The pelvis has been opened to show a dilated pelvis with a trabeculated luminal surface.
•The renal parenchyma shows multiple cysts (arrows).
•This upper pole was associated with a duplicated ureter that was tortuous, dilated and obstructed at the uretero- vesicle junction (not shown). The remainder of the kidney was normal with a separate ureter and left in the patient.
